Client Reporting - Maintenance Log - Team Use
Download and customize a free Client Reporting Maintenance Log Team Use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.
| Maintenance Log | |||||||
|---|---|---|---|---|---|---|---|
| Date | Client Name | Asset/Equipment ID | Maintenance Type | Description of Work | Technician Name | Status | Next Due Date |
| Pending | |||||||
| Team Use – For Internal Reporting Purposes Only | |||||||
Excel Template for Client Reporting – Maintenance Log (Team Use)
This comprehensive Excel template is specifically designed for teams responsible for ongoing client maintenance operations, with a strong focus on structured, accurate, and collaborative reporting. The "Maintenance Log" serves as the central repository of all service activities performed across client assets, while the "Client Reporting" functionality ensures stakeholders receive timely summaries and insights. Engineered for Team Use, this template enables multiple users to collaborate securely within a shared environment—perfectly suited for field technicians, maintenance supervisors, and account managers.
Sheet Names & Structure
- Maintenance Log (Main): The central data table containing all maintenance entries with real-time updates.
- Client Summary Dashboard: A dynamic overview of key metrics across clients, including completion rates, pending tasks, and service history.
- Team Activity Tracker: A log showing who performed which task and when—ideal for accountability and performance tracking.
- Client Reports (Monthly/Quarterly): Pre-formatted report templates that auto-populate from the main log, streamlining client deliverables.
- Templates & Instructions: A guide sheet with sample entries, formula explanations, and usage guidelines.
Table Structures and Columns (Maintenance Log - Main Sheet)
The primary table contains 14 structured columns designed to capture all essential maintenance information:
| Column | Data Type | Description & Requirements |
|---|---|---|
| Date of Service (DD/MM/YYYY) | Date | When the maintenance activity occurred. Must be entered using Excel’s date format. |
| Client Name | Text (Dropdown List) | From a predefined list of clients to ensure consistency and prevent typos. |
| Asset ID/Serial Number | Text/Number | A unique identifier for each client equipment or system (e.g., HVAC-023). |
| Location (Site Address) | Text | Full physical address or site name where the asset is installed. |
| Maintenance Type | List (Dropdown) | Predictive, Preventive, Corrective, Emergency Repair, Routine Checkup. |
| Technician Name | Text (Dropdown) Team member who performed the task. | |
| Description of Work Done | Text (Long) | Detailed summary of what was inspected, replaced, or repaired. |
| Parts Used | Text/Number | List of parts with quantities used (e.g., Filter X4). |
| Hours Spent | Numeric (Decimal) | Total time spent on the task in hours (e.g., 2.5). |
| Status | List (Dropdown) Open, In Progress, Completed, Cancelled. | |
| Next Scheduled Date | Date | Predicted date for the next maintenance based on service intervals. |
| Notes / Follow-ups | Text (Long) | Any unresolved issues, client feedback, or action items. |
| Date Created | Date (Auto) | |
| Last Modified By | Text (Auto) Uses a formula referencing the user name input on the Team Tracker sheet. |
Formulas Required
- Status Indicator: =IF([@[Status]]="Completed", "✓", IF([@[Status]]="In Progress", "🔄", "❌")) — Provides visual status markers.
- Days Since Service: =TODAY()-[Date of Service] — Tracks how long it’s been since last maintenance.
- Next Due Alert: =IF([@[Next Scheduled Date]]-TODAY()<=7, "Due Soon!", IF([@[Next Scheduled Date]]
- Monthly Summary (Dashboard): Use
COUNTIFS(),SUMIFS(), andDATEVALUE()to calculate task volume by month, client, or technician. - Monthly Summary (Dashboard): Use
Conditional Formatting Rules
- Overdue Entries: If "Next Scheduled Date" is older than today → Highlight in red with bold text.
- Due Soon (within 7 days): Yellow background with dark orange text.
- Status: Completed: Green fill, white checkmark icon.
- High Hours Spent: If "Hours Spent" > 5 → Light red shade to flag high-effort jobs.
User Instructions
- Access: Open the template from a shared drive or cloud platform (OneDrive/SharePoint) with proper permissions.
- Add New Entries: Fill in all columns on the "Maintenance Log" sheet. Use dropdowns for consistency.
- Update Status: Change the status as work progresses; this automatically updates dashboards.
- Generate Reports: Navigate to the "Client Reports" tab, select a client and period (month/quarter), and click “Generate Report” to auto-fill data.
- Maintain Data Integrity: Avoid editing formulas. Use the "Templates & Instructions" sheet for guidance.
- Team Coordination: Technicians should log their work daily; supervisors review weekly via the "Team Activity Tracker".
Example Rows (Sample Data)
| Date of Service | Client Name | Asset ID | Location | Maintenance Type | Technician Name |
|---|---|---|---|---|---|
| 03/04/2025 | Sunrise Healthcare | AC-147 | 123 Medical Lane, Boston, MA 02115 | Preventive | |
| 05/04/2025 | Downtown Tech Center | UPS-881 | 789 Innovation Blvd, Chicago, IL 60613 |
Recommended Charts & Dashboards (Client Reporting)
The "Client Summary Dashboard" includes the following visual elements:
- Bar Chart: Maintenance frequency per client (monthly). Helps identify high-demand clients.
- Pie Chart: Distribution of maintenance types (Preventive vs. Corrective) to measure proactive service levels.
- Gantt Chart (Simplified): Visual timeline of upcoming and overdue tasks for priority planning.
- KPI Widgets: Display key metrics such as “% Completed Tasks”, “Average Response Time”, and “Top 3 Technicians by Volume”.
This Excel template enhances transparency, streamlines client reporting, and supports collaborative team use—ensuring that every maintenance action contributes to a comprehensive, professional, and data-driven service experience.
⬇️ Download as Excel✏️ Edit online as ExcelCreate your own Excel template with our GoGPT AI prompt:
GoGPT